探索AI赋能的Python编程新时代
随着人工智能技术的飞速发展,编程工具也在不断革新。如今,开发者不再需要依赖传统的IDE和繁琐的手动编码过程,借助智能化的编程助手,即使是编程小白也能迅速上手并完成复杂的项目。本文将带您走进基于AI的Python编程学习之旅,探讨如何利用智能化工具提升编程效率,并推荐一款强大的开发环境——它不仅能够简化代码编写,还能帮助您更好地理解和优化代码。
最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E
AI驱动的Python编程体验
在过去的几年里,Python已经成为最受欢迎的编程语言之一,广泛应用于数据科学、机器学习、Web开发等多个领域。然而,对于初学者来说,掌握这门语言并非易事。传统的学习路径通常包括阅读教程、观看视频以及反复实践,但这往往需要耗费大量的时间和精力。现在,有了AI的支持,一切都变得简单得多。
以优快云、GitCode和华为云CodeArts IDE联合推出的智能编程工具为例,这款集成了先进AI技术的跨平台集成开发环境(IDE),为Python编程带来了前所未有的便捷性。通过内置的AI对话框,用户可以使用自然语言与系统交互,快速实现代码补全、生成注释、调试程序等功能。这意味着即使是没有编程经验的新手,也可以轻松入门Python,并逐步提升自己的技能水平。
应用场景:从基础到进阶
1. 初学者的理想选择
对于刚刚接触编程的学生或职场新人而言,最头疼的问题莫过于如何理解代码逻辑并写出正确的语法。传统方式下,他们需要查阅大量资料,甚至花费数周时间才能掌握基本概念。而现在,只需打开AI IDE,在其中输入问题或者描述想要实现的功能,系统就会自动生成相应的代码片段。例如,当您想创建一个简单的“Hello World”程序时,只需告诉AI:“我想打印一句话”,它就能立即给出答案。这种直观的操作方式大大降低了学习门槛,让每个人都能享受到编程的乐趣。
2. 提高工作效率
随着项目规模的增长和个人能力的提高,开发者面临的挑战也随之增加。此时,AI IDE的价值就更加凸显出来了。它可以自动分析现有代码结构,识别潜在错误,并提供改进建议;同时支持全局代码生成/改写功能,使得修改多个文件变得轻而易举。更重要的是,借助于强大的DeepSeek-V3模型,该工具能够深入理解业务需求,根据上下文环境智能生成高质量的代码段落,从而显著缩短开发周期,提高生产效率。
3. 深入理解与优化
除了简化编码过程外,AI IDE还提供了丰富的辅助功能来帮助开发者深入了解所编写的代码。比如,通过智能问答模块,用户可以获得关于特定函数用法、最佳实践等方面的指导;又如,利用解释代码特性,可以在不改变原有逻辑的前提下查看每一行语句的作用及其执行顺序。此外,针对性能瓶颈问题,AI IDE会自动进行分析并提出优化方案,确保最终产品既高效又稳定。
实战案例分享
为了让大家更直观地感受到AI IDE的强大之处,这里分享一个实际应用案例。某高校计算机系的学生小李正在准备毕业设计——开发一个图书借阅系统。起初,他对数据库操作、界面设计等环节感到十分棘手,但在尝试了AI IDE之后,一切都迎刃而解了。通过简单的对话形式,他不仅完成了前后端代码的搭建,还成功实现了用户登录、书籍查询等功能。最重要的是,在整个过程中,AI始终陪伴左右,及时给予帮助和支持,使他能够专注于创意构思而非技术细节。
下载指南与未来展望
如果您也想体验这种革命性的编程方式,不妨下载并安装AI IDE吧!目前,该软件已正式上线各大应用商店,完全免费且无需额外配置即可使用。相信在不久的将来,随着更多开发者加入到这个充满活力的社区中来,我们将共同见证AI技术给编程世界带来的无限可能。
总之,AI IDE不仅仅是一款编程工具,更是每位程序员身边不可或缺的得力助手。无论您是初出茅庐的新手还是经验丰富的专家,它都将为您带来全新的编程体验,助力您在这个快速变化的时代中脱颖而出。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考